BBCOR (Drop-3) Sizing Chart

In high school and college, the rules are strict: all high school bats and college bats must be a -3 drop weight and feature a 2 5/8" barrel diameter. Use the guide below to find your optimal length based on your height and hitting style.

Player Height Bat Length Weight (oz) Recommended For
5'1" - 5'8" 31" - 32" 28 - 29 oz Smaller HS players / Contact hitters
5'9" - 6'0" 32" - 33" 29 - 30 oz Most HS & College players
6'1" + 33" - 34" 30 - 31 oz Power hitters & Collegiate athletes

BBCOR & College Play FAQ

What does BBCOR stand for?
It stands for Batted Ball Coefficient of Restitution. It measures the "trampoline effect" of a bat to ensure metal bats perform more like traditional wood bats for safety and game integrity.

Are wood bats legal for high school?
Yes. Most one-piece solid wood bats are automatically legal, though they are often heavier and more difficult to swing than balanced BBCOR metal bats.
